In late 19th century Mexico, a ruthless outlaw and his gang seek refuge at a remote inn. They get involved with a young woman accused of witchcraft. As night falls, the inn's guests are attacked by supernatural creatures.

From Dusk Till Dawn 3: The Hangman's Daughter is a 1999 American horror Western film directed by P. J. Pesce. It serves as a prequel to the 1996 film From Dusk till Dawn. It was released directly to video and was nominated at the 26th Saturn Awards for "Best Home Video Release". In late 2010, the production of a fourth film in the series was discussed, but, as of August 2012, further work on this possibility has not been revealed. A TV series adaptation was released in 2014.
